The World Grand Prix Racers are major characters of Pixar's 12th full-lenght animated feature film Cars 2. They are racers who were chosen by Miles Axlerod to promote his new wonder-fuel Allinol. The competition unites the best athletes of all race types from all over the world to determine the world's fastest car. Though there are 12 spots in each race, there is actually an odd number of 11 racers.

In Cars 2: The Video Game, all the WGP racers appear as playable characters, with the exception of Rip Clutchgoneski and Lewis Hamilton (the latter appeared in beta screenshots of the PSP version, but was removed from the final game; in the PC and console versions for game there is an unused model for Lewis, he also can only be found in the PSP version of the game, as an opponent during races).

Kinect Rush: A Disney Pixar Adventure[]

In Kinect Rush: A Disney/Pixar Adventure, Francesco is the only WGP racer that appeared in the Bomb Squad level in Tokyo Japan. When the player is a male, their avatar as a car is the same car model as Lewis Hamilton. When the player is female, it is the same car model as Carla Veloso.

Disney INFINITY[]

In Disney Infinity, Lightning and Francesco are the only WGP racers who are playable characters, while Carla and Shu are not playable. Although Raoul ÇaRoule and Max Schnell appear on pictures in Ramone's House of Body Art, they do not make a physical appearance in the game.

Trivia[]

  • Unlike for the other racers, the paint job of Lightning McQueen, Lewis Hamilton, and Nigel Gearsley are not colored after their respective country's flag. However, Gearsley bears the British racing green along with the Union Jack (British Flag) painted on his hood. McQueen and Hamilton bear their personal colors. It can also be noted that the main color of Jeff Gorvette, yellow, is not a color of his country flag, which is included in his design however. It's also the same for Max Schnell, which his main color is indigo purple, however, his country flag is included in his design.
  • Some racers bear their racing league logo. Lightning McQueen is for the Piston Cup, Francesco Bernoulli for Formula Racer, Raoul ÇaRoule for the GRC, and Max Schnell for the WtcL. It can be noted that all are allusions to real racing leagues.
  • Suprisingly, Rip Clutchgoneski is the only racer who is not seen with a pit crew chief, just a couple of pitties. However, this may just be a coincidence, as he is a rookie.
  • In the Piston Cup in the first movie, the racer's names were not mentioned. However, in the World Grand Prix, the racer's names were mentioned (except for Max Schnell, however his name was already revealed on a promotional image of him and his last name was shown on the after race of Japan)
  • Carla Veloso is the only female racer in the World Grand Prix.
  • Lightning McQueen is not actually the fastest car in the WGP. In fact he isn't even in the top three. Francesco Bernoulli, Carla Veloso and Shu Todoroki are all faster than him.
    • However, he shares his top speed with Jeff Gorvette and Miguel Camino, tying them together for fourth in terms of the top speed.
